Masala develops the ancient theory of Indian Raga into the context of
European Ambient music, modal Jazz and some of the most innovative
experiments with techno music.
Within the present trend to recover melodic-modal concepts from ethnic
music, Raga theory is an invaluable instrument for analysis and
development: it helps us to understand the essence of all kinds of music
in the world , most of which, like raggae and blues, have by now reached
the status of musical heritage.
Masala doesn’t mean the fusion of Western and Eastern music but rather
